United Nations has warned that constant violations of the rights ofPalestinians threaten the two-state solution to the Israeli-Palestinianconflict.
In a statement, the United Nations Secretary-General Antonio Guterres saidthat the situation in the Occupied Palestinian Territory including EastJerusalem continues to pose a significant challenge to international peaceand security.
He said persistent violations of the rights of Palestinians along with theexpansion of settlements risk is eroding the prospect of a two-statesolution.
He reiterated that the overall goal of two states living side by side inpeace and security remains as this includes fulfilling the legitimatenational aspirations of both peoples, with borders based on the 1967 linesand Jerusalem as the capital of both states.
